<p>The <strong>S&amp;P/ASX 200 Materials Index</strong> (ASX: XMJ) fell 1.17% today, but three ASX mining shares charged higher. </p>



<p>The <strong>Winsome Resources Ltd </strong>(<a class="tickerized-link" href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-wr1/">ASX: WR1</a>), <strong>Victory Goldfields Ltd</strong> (ASX: 1VG), and <strong>Burley Minerals Ltd </strong>(<a class="tickerized-link" href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-bur/">ASX: BUR</a>) share prices all lifted today. </p>



<p>So why did these ASX <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/investing-education/top-mining-shares/">mining shares</a> have such a good day? Let's take a look.</p>



<h2 class="wp-block-heading" id="h-burley-minerals">Burley Minerals</h2>



<p>Burley Minerals shares soared 67% in early trade today to 40 cents before retreating. The company's share price closed 33% ahead at 32 cents. </p>



<p>Burley shares exploded on lithium <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/2022/11/17/guess-which-asx-lithium-share-exploded-67-today/">acquisition news</a>. The ASX mining share has entered an exclusive agreement to acquire the Chubb Lithium project in Quebec, Canada and the Mt James and Dragon Projects in Western Australia. </p>



<p>Burley managing director Wayne Richards said: </p>



<blockquote class="w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ow"><p>The strategic and geographic location of all three potential projects are located in world class mining provinces and in Tier 1 jurisdictions of Australia and Canada.</p></blockquote>



<h2 class="wp-block-heading" id="h-victory-goldfields">Victory Goldfields</h2>



<p>The Victory Goldfields share price soared 28% today, ending the day at 28 cents.</p>



<p>Investors bought up Victory shares on rare earth news. Positive magnetic and gravity survey data <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-1vg/announcements/2022-11-17/6a1122596/follow-up-drilling-to-commence-at-the-alkaline-intrusion/">provide grounds</a> for a diamond drilling program at the company's alkaline intrusion prospect. </p>



<p>Alkaline intrusions are seen as "engine rooms for rare earth elements and critical metals", the company highlighted. </p>



<p>Angled drill holes are planned to "assess the extent of country rock alteration adjacent to the intrusion".  Victory has appointed Orlando Drilling to perform the diamond drilling program. </p>



<h2 class="wp-block-heading" id="h-winsome-resources">Winsome Resources</h2>



<p>Winsome Resources shares rocketed 33% to $1.17 apiece. </p>



<p>The ASX mining share did not release any news to the market today. However, Winsome shares have soared 234% in a month. They have surged 216% since market close on 27 October alone. </p>



<p>On 28 October, the company's share price skyrocketed after it found <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/2022/11/17/why-has-asx-lithium-share-winsome-resources-rocketed-220-in-a-month/">significant pegmatite intercepts</a> at the Adina and Cancet lithium projects in Canada. </p>



<p>On Tuesday this week, Winsome <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-wr1/announcements/2022-11-15/6a1122150/winsome-to-raise-6.8m-to-advance-lithium-projects/">advised</a> it would raise $6.8 million to advance the Cancet and Adina lithium projects.</p>

<p>The&nbsp;<strong>S&amp;P/ASX 200 Materials</strong>&nbsp;<strong>Index</strong>&nbsp;(ASX: XMJ) is in the red today, down 1.18%. But this <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/investing-education/lithium-shares/">ASX lithium share</a> is bucking the trend. </p>



<p>The <strong>Burley Minerals Ltd&nbsp;</strong>(<a class="tickerized-link" href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-bur/">ASX: BUR</a>) share price is on the rise by 25% today to 30 cents. However, in earlier trade, Burley Minerals shares skyrocketed 67% to 40 cents. </p>



<p>So why is this ASX lithium share having such a top run today? </p>



<h2 class="wp-block-heading" id="h-acquisition-news-for-lithium-explorer">Acquisition news for lithium explorer</h2>



<p>Investors are buying up Burley shares today on lithium <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/definitions/mergers-and-acquisitions/">acquisition</a> news. <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-bur/announcements/2022-11-17/6a1122637/burley-to-acquire-100-of-canadian-gascoyne-li-projects/">Burley has entered an "exclusive agreement"</a> to take ownership of 100% of the Chubb Lithium Project in Quebec, Canada. </p>



<p>Further, under the deal, Burley would also acquire the Mt James and Dragon Projects, prospective for lithium, in the Gascoyne region of Western Australia. </p>



<p>The project widens Burley's exploration pipeline to high-grade lithium-bearing spodumene projects. </p>



<p>Drilling at the Chubb Lithium project has shown the presence of spodumene-bearing lithium pegmatites. </p>



<p>Burley is also an <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/investing-education/iron-ore-shares/">iron ore explorer</a>, with a 70% stake in the Yerecoin Project near Perth in Western Australia. </p>



<p>Commenting on today's news, Burley managing director Wayne Richards said: </p>



<blockquote class="wp-block-quote is-layout-flow wp-block-quote-is-layout-flow"><p>We are very pleased to announce the signing of this Agreement to acquire such high-potential Lithium Projects in jurisdictions complemented by other major Lithium explorers and developers.  </p><p>The strategic and geographic location of all three potential projects are located in world class mining provinces and in Tier 1 jurisdictions of Australia and Canada.</p></blockquote>



<h2 class="wp-block-heading" id="h-asx-lithium-share-burley-s-share-price-snapshot">ASX lithium share Burley's share price snapshot </h2>



<p>Burley Minerals has soared 27% in a year, while it has surged 46% in the year to date. In the past month, the company's share price has rocketed ahead 122%. </p>



<p>For perspective, the ASX 200 Materials Index has climbed 14% in a year. </p>



<p>This ASX lithium share has a <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/definitions/market-capitalisation/">market capitalisation</a> of about $10.3 million based on the current share price. </p>

                                                                                            <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<strong>Burley Minerals Ltd</strong> <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-bur/">(ASX: BUR)</a> share price has hit the ASX boards running on Wednesday.</p>
<p>Earlier today, the iron ore and base metals explorer and developer's shares rocketed as much as 105% to a high of 41 cents.</p>
<p>The Burley Minerals share price eventually closed the day 87.5% higher than its listing price at 37.5 cents.</p>
<h2>Why did the Burley Minerals share price rocket higher?</h2>
<p>Investors were bidding its shares higher today following the completion of its initial public offering (<a href="https://www.fool.com.au/definitions/initial-public-offering/">IPO</a>). They appear to see a lot of potential in the company's <a href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-bur/announcements/2021-07-07/6a1039858/burley-minerals-presentation/">Yerecoin Project in Western Australia</a>.</p>
<p>The Yerecoin Project comprises two exploration licenses that cover 105.5 km2 of land close to the exciting Julimar Project owned by <strong>Chalice Mining Ltd</strong> (<a class="tickerized-link" href="https://www.fool.com.au/tickers/asx-chn/">ASX: CHN</a>).</p>
<p>According to its prospectus, exploration activities to date have defined significant JORC-compliant magnetite resources within the project totalling 247 Mt @ 29.9% Fe producing a 68.1% Fe concentrate.</p>
<p>In addition, it notes that a number of historical studies have also been completed and the potential for "Julimar Style" PGE-Cu-Ni mineralisation has also been established.</p>
<p>Given how the Chalice Mining share price is up 650% over the last 12 months thanks largely to successful exploration at Julimar, investors appear optimistic the same could happen to the company's shares if it has similar successes.</p>
<h2>The Burley Minerals IPO</h2>
<p>Burley Minerals raised $6 million via the issue of 30,000,000 shares at a price of $0.20 each. This gave it a market capitalisation of $12.2 million.</p>
<p>However, with the Burley Minerals share price charging higher today. Its market capitalisation has now climbed to almost $23 million.</p>
<p>The funds raised from the IPO will support current drilling of the western limb of Yerecoin Main. Management notes that there is immediate potential to extend and upgrade magnetite resources at Yerecoin Main and Yerecoin South.</p>
<p>There is also the potential for discovery of additional magnetite resources. Management highlights that there is an eye-shaped magnetic feature requiring investigation for presence of ultramafics and magnetite mineralisation.</p>
